Description:
Distracted With Care And Anguish (Insanae Et Vanae Curae) is a motet for four voices. The accompaniment for Great Organ has been arranged by Joseph Barnby.
Joseph Haydn (1732-1809) wasan Austrian composer who became the figurehead of the classical movement. He formed a close and mutually respectful relationship with Mozart, and later taught Beethoven, but it was his compositions that left an indelible mark onthe musical landscape of Western Europe.
